Japanese utilities expect a slow recovery in electric power demand toward March after a 5% drop in the April-June quarter though some are less confident that the worst is over.

In the April-June quarter, May was the weakest month with power demand falling 9%, according to the Organization for Cross-regional Coordination of Transmission Operators, Japan . “Power demand will slowly pick up, but it won’t return to the levels before the pandemic during this financial year,” he told an earnings news conference last week.
